lemonde.fr9 mesi fa

Nepal lifts social media ban after deadly protests

Nepal's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li has ordered an investigation into the deaths of at least 19 protesters, who were killed in clashes with police over online restrictions and corruption.

dailysabah.com9 mesi fa

Deadly Nepal protests over social media ban bring down PM Oli

Nepal’s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li resigned Tuesday following nationwide youth protests and a deadly crackdown that killed at least 19 people, marking...
